Plan de formation

Concepteur Développeur d’Applications

Vous souhaitez renforcer vos compétences en développement et devenir polyvalent ? Apprenez à concevoir et développer des applications complètes, du front au back, tout en acquérant les compétences pour piloter des projets et coordonner des équipes.

Durée

12 mois - Alternance

525 h de cours
+1000 h de période en entreprise

Certification

Titre professionnel RNCP
Niveau 6 (ex niv. II) - Bac + 3/4

CONCEPTEUR DÉVELOPPEUR D'APPLICATIONS

Modalités

50% en présentiel
50% en téléprésentiel

Métiers

Développeur junior full stack Java / Android
Développeur junior J2EE
Chef de projet junior

Qu'allez-vous apprendre pendant la formation Concepteur Développeur d'Applications ?

Sébastien

Sébastien ANDRÉ
Référent de la formation

Le métier de concepteur développeur d’application : un pont entre l’idée et la réalité numérique.

Le rôle du concepteur-développeur d’application est fondamental dans la création d’applications informatiques, qu’elles soient web, mobiles ou desktop. L’objectif de cette formation est de vous permettre de partir d’un besoin client pour concevoir, développer et déployer une application, en maîtrisant les technologies modernes et les bonnes pratiques du secteur. Vous apprendrez à formaliser ce besoin sous forme de cahier des charges, à en déduire les spécifications fonctionnelles et techniques, puis à développer l’application en respectant les standards de qualité et de sécurité.

Durant la formation, vous serez amené à travailler sur des études de cas et des projets concrets, en utilisant des outils adaptés pour chaque étape du projet : la conception, le développement (front-end et back-end), ainsi que la gestion des bases de données. L’importance de la phase de conception ne saurait être sous-estimée, car elle guide tout le processus de développement, en garantissant une architecture solide et évolutive. Vous découvrirez également les enjeux des tests fonctionnels et techniques, notamment les tests unitaires, pour vous assurer que l’application est fiable avant son déploiement.

Le DevOps est un autre aspect essentiel de cette formation, vous permettant de comprendre les méthodes d’intégration et de déploiement continu. Cette approche garantit une gestion optimisée des mises à jour et une réactivité accrue dans les environnements de production. À travers cette formation, vous serez préparé à relever les défis techniques et organisationnels du métier, tout en garantissant la satisfaction client et la réussite du projet.

Le programme

Objectifs

👉 Concevoir et développer des composants d’interface utilisateur en intégrant les recommandations de sécurité
👉 Concevoir et développer la persistance des données en intégrant les recommandations de sécurité
👉 Concevoir et développer une application multicouche répartie en intégrant les recommandations de sécurité

Pré-requis

Il est fortement conseillé d’avoir déjà fait une formation de niveau Bac +2 avant d’intégrer ce niveau de formation, nous considérons que les élèves intégrant cette année sont déjà à l’aise avec la programmation front-end et back-end, ainsi que sur les bases de requête SQL.

Déroulé

Nos formations sont basées essentiellement sur la pratique et l’accompagnement individuel de l’équipe pédagogique ce qui permet d’adapter la courbe d’apprentissage aux capacités de chacun.e.

 

Durant cette première journée nous finaliserons les formalités administratives et reviendrons sur le déroulé de l’année du point de vue du planning et du travail à fournir ; mais aussi sur ce qui est attendu de chacun pour rendre l’expérience de formation agréable à toutes et à tous.
Ça sera aussi l’occasion de faire connaissance et d’initier la cohésion du groupe indispensable à une année réussie !

A travers divers mises en situation, vous apprendrez à organiser un projet et à planifier sa réalisation. Compréhension et formalisation du besoin, vous préparerez le travail et apprendrez les méthodes qui vous serviront tout au long de la vie du projet.

Bien plus qu’une simple étape, la conception est un processus essentiel dans le développement d’applications. Vous apprendrez à détailler et structurer votre application avant même que le code ne soit écrit ; dans le but de résoudre des problèmes complexes en organisant de manière systématique les différentes composantes et en définissant comment elles interagiront.

Le cœur d’une application est sa base de données, notamment sa structuration puis sa conception. A cela se joint aussi de bonnes connaissances en termes de requêtage mais aussi de sécurité dans le paramétrage de la base (gestion des droits) que dans la gestion des données (intégrité des données, sécurité). Vous travaillerez que la modélisation de la base de données de votre projet fil rouge (MCD, MLD, MPD, Dictionnaire de données, etc…).

La configuration de son environnement de travail est cruciale pour un développeur. Vous apprendrez à installer et configurer tous les outils nécessaires à la réalisation de votre projet (Git, Docker, IDE, etc…), afin d’obtenir un environnement conforme à celui de production.

Nous partons du principe que vous avez déjà une connaissance d’un langage de programmation (JS, PHP, C#, C++, Python, Java, etc..). Ainsi, les bases de la programmation procédurale et surtout de la Programmation Orientée Objet (POO) seront rapidement abordées pour vous amener à comprendre et utiliser des notions avancées en termes de POO.
Une fois ces notions acquises, vous appliquerez vos connaissances sur un framework front et un framework back.

Discipline cruciale du développement qui vise à garantir que les applications fonctionnent de manière fiable, répondent aux exigences spécifiées et offrent une expérience utilisateur optimale ; le test est un processus consistant à identifier, évaluer et corriger les défauts dans le code source avant et après le déploiement d’une application. En plus de la réalisation de tests automatisés, vous aborderez aussi le vocabulaire ISQTB, certification de référence du test logiciel.

Le DevOps est non seulement une façon de penser l’informatique mais aussi toute une série d’outils qu’il est dorénavant important de connaître. A travers la présentation de certains d’entre eux, qui s’articulent et sont complémentaires dans la mise en place d’une architecture DevOps, vous réaliserez des pratiques sur des cas concrets, impliquant la mise en place des outils de qualité de code.

Vous connaissez toutes les ficelles du métier ? C’est le moment de vous confronter à un véritable projet ! Durant ces 3 semaines, vous aurez un projet complet à réaliser et à présenter. Organisation du projet, conception, réalisation et déploiement, vous devrez remettre en application tout ce que vous avez acquis tout au long de l’année.

 

Une rencontre individuelle est réalisée à la fin de chaque séquence de la formation afin d’identifier les points positifs, les axes d’amélioration et le travail réalisé par l’étudiant. Ces rencontres permettent aussi d’approfondir et d’affiner au fur et à mesure de la formation le projet professionnel de l’étudiant.
Un accompagnement est aussi mis en œuvre afin d’assister les étudiants dans la rédaction des différents documents relatifs au jury, mais aussi de les aider dans la préparation de l’oral du jury.

C’est le moment de faire le point sur l’année écoulée ? Comment l’avez-vous vécu ? Ce que vous auriez aimé voir ou faire autrement ? Ce que vous faites après la formation ? etc… Nous clôturons aussi les formalités administratives.

Cette compétence englobe l’analyse des besoins et des fonctionnalités d’une application web ou web mobile, l’adaptation du langage utilisé lors des interactions avec le client, ainsi que la participation active aux réunions techniques en exprimant ses idées de manière structurée, le tout, aussi bien en français qu’en anglais. Elle inclut également la capacité à adapter sa communication lors d’échanges avec des personnes en situation de handicap, à rédiger des documents techniques clairs et concis, et à rechercher des informations dans des documents techniques tout en étant capable de communiquer efficacement sur leur contenu.

Cette compétence consiste à maintenir ses compétences et sa capacité opérationnelle en mettant en place un système de veille technologique pour rester à jour sur les évolutions technologiques et les problématiques de sécurité des applications web ou web mobiles. Elle implique également la capacité à s’auto-former en recherchant des informations sur Internet, en consultant des documentations techniques (y compris en anglais) et en sollicitant l’aide de personnes compétentes pour résoudre les problèmes rencontrés.

En fonction de vos besoins, le service emploi du CEFIM peut vous accompagner dans ces démarches et proposer des actions personnalisées :
Identifier le secteur d’activité
Bilan professionnel et personnel
Confronter son projet à la réalité du marché
Réaliser son CV
Identifier les annonces
Construire son parcours
Identifier ses points forts et ses axes d’améliorations
Remettre en forme son CV
Préparer des entretiens professionnels
Travailler sur sa candidature
Technique de communication utile pour les entretiens
Etre identifié sur les Réseaux Sociaux

Environnement de travail optimal

Des salles modernes, climatisées et équipées d’outils professionnels pour vous préparer dans les meilleures conditions.

Aide à l’équipement

Une aide directe jusqu’à 500€ pour vous permettre de vous équiper dès le début de la formation.

Label Grande École du Numérique

Une reconnaissance nationale pour l’excellence de notre programme, alignée sur les attentes des professionnels.

Les prochaines sessions

🗓️
6 octobre 2025
au 2 octobre 2026

35h / semaine

Candidatures ouvertes prochainement
 
  • Spécialisation Java ou Web
  • 525h de cours / au moins 1000h de période en entreprise
    (base contrat d'apprentissage 12 mois)
  • 50% en présentiel / 50% en distanciel
  • Regroupement présentiel sur les Campus de Tours
  • Modalités de financement : 20 places accessibles en contrat d'apprentissage ou contrat de professionnalisation
TOURS
Logo Région FSE

Action "SE FORMER AUX METIERS DU NUMERIQUE-37-INDRE-ET-LOIRE"

Formation organisée avec le concours financier de la Région Centre–Val de Loire et de : 

  • l’Union européenne. L’Europe s’engage en région Centre-Val de Loire avec le Fonds Social Européen 
  • l’Etat dans le cadre du Pacte Régional Investissement pour les Compétences

Comment intégrer la formation Concepteur Développeur d'Applications ?

01

Inscription et candidature

Remplissez le formulaire d’inscription en ligne et soumettez votre dossier de candidature pour débuter le processus.

02

Test en ligne

Les admissions incluent un test en ligne et un entretien (en fonction du dossier). Ces étapes visent à évaluer vos compétences et votre motivation.

Temps estimé : 5 à 7 heures.

03

Réponse d'admission

L’équipe des admissions s’engage à vous apporter une réponse, qu’elle soit positive ou négative, dans un délai maximum de 7 jours.

Quelques chiffres clés...

Sources : enquêtes internes CEFIM

Taux de retour à l'emploi
0 %
Réussite à l'examen
0 %
Note de satisfaction (/5)
0

Accessibilité

Situation de handicap

Mégane SOUCHET

Mégane Souchet
Référente handicap du CEFIM

Vous avez une reconnaissance RQTH et vous vous demandez si nous pouvons vous accueillir ?

Nous accueillons régulièrement des étudiants avec différents handicaps sur nos formations. Pour les handicaps moteurs, nos locaux et nos équipements sont tout à fait adaptés aux normes en vigueur.
Pour les autres handicaps, l’accessibilité peut être adaptée.

L’inclusion de tous et toutes dans la formation est une valeur importante pour nous et nous prendrons toujours le temps de vous accueillir spécifiquement pour évaluer avec vous notre capacité à nous adapter à votre empêchement.

Vous pouvez dès maintenant prendre un rendez-vous avec notre référente handicap qui saura vous accueillir et être à votre écoute.

Ou vous pouvez lui passer un message directement : handicap@cefim.eu

Et au-delà du premier rendez-vous, il sera la personne à votre écoute tout au long de la formation.

Nous contacter

Vous avez des questions ou un projet en tête ?

Contactez-nous pour être mis en relation avec un conseiller. Nous sommes là pour :

Échanger sur vos idées et objectifs.

Vous accompagner dans votre orientation.

Vous inviter à découvrir le CEFIM lors d’une journée porte ouverte.

Infos pratiques

Journée portes ouvertes

Samedi 11 janvier 2025 - 10h à 12h

Disponible Hors Parcoursup – Bac+2 à Bac+5 – Distanciel et présentiel – Diplômes reconnus par l’état et les entreprises